Port San Carlos

Port San Carlos is located on the northern bank of the inlet known as Port San Carlos,[1] off San Carlos Water on the Western coast of East Falkland, in the Falkland Islands. It is sometimes nicknamed "KC" after former owner Keith Cameron.[2]

The port takes its name from the ship San Carlos which visited in 1768.

It is north of its namesake San Carlos.
